What should she do after exchanging her old gold for new gold, out of ignorance of the Hadith in which the Messenger of Allah, peace and blessings be upon him, prohibited exchanging gold for gold and silver for silver?
Source: FtawySummarized from the full answer at Ftawy · imported Sep 2, 2026
If the exchange was done with equal weights of the two gold items, then there is no objection. However, if there was an excess in one of them, then the exchange is forbidden, due to the saying of the Prophet, peace and blessings be upon him: "Gold for gold, silver for silver, and salt for salt, like for like, equal for equal, hand to hand." Narrated by Muslim. The sale must be annulled if possible. If you are unable to do so, then there is no blame upon you due to your ignorance of the Sharia ruling, and ignorance absolves one of sin.
